See a giant kauri tree and ride a bush railway. A farm stay will give you the opportunity to meet some real "Kiwis". The first part of the tour finishes at the geothermal spa town of Rotorua with the opportunity to experience the local Maori culture.
The Volcanoes and Glow-worms tour covers a great diversity of scenery from farmland to lakes, forests and the magnificent volcanoes of Tongariro Natinoal Park. Stay on a sheep farm (meet some of New Zealand's 45 million sheep) and visit the world famous Waitomo Caves for a magical glow-worm display.
Tour Itinerary
Day 1: Auckland. Lunch by one of Auckland's volcanic cones, then a little sightseeing in the City of Sails.
Day 2: Thames. Follow the Firth of Thames coast, past the Miranda Shore Bird sanctuary, to Thames and a comfortable lodge on the water's edge.
Day 3: Coromandel. Visit a working gold mining museum and have lunch at the Rapaura Water Gardens.
Day 4: Whitianga. Time to visit the craft shops and potteries, and take a ride on the quaint bush railway, then relax on the fabulous beach at Whitianga.
Day 5: Whangamata. Walk to Cathedral Cove and visit another magnificent beach at Hahei.
Day 6: Matamata. Through the Karangahake Gorge to the fertile Waikato Valley and a farmstay.
Day 7-8: Rotorua. We cycle over the Mamaku Plateau, followed by a great descent to the spa city of Rotorua. A rest day offers many options: geysers and bubbling mud pools, rafting, Mt Tarawera, fishing and lots more.
Day 9: Taupo. We now head for Lake Taupo of trout fishing fame, with a visit to the dramatic Huka Falls a must.
Day 10-11: Tongariro. The three volcanoes, Tongariro, Ngauruhoe and Ruapehu are the dramatic features of Tongariro National Park. Here we relax in style and comfort at the Grand Chateau.
Day 12: Pio Pio. We wind our way down to King Country, known for sheep farms and limestone formations, for a second farm stay.
Day 13: Waitomo. Our hosts will show us a little of their lifestyle and then it is a short, easy ride to the old world charm of Waitomo Caves.
Day 14-15: Auckland. A visit to the world famous caves is a must, with the option of black water rafting for the more daring. We then take delightful quiet country roads to Te Awamutu to drive to Auckland.
